Sales Insights Program Manager

Summary

The Sales Insights Program Manager will define and drive the adoption of an AI-enabled data insights backbone for HP's partner sales organization. The role involves translating business processes into product requirements to improve sales productivity and data-driven decision-making.

Sales Insights Program Manager

Description -

Job Summary:

  • Define, deliver and drive adoption of the information and insights backbone for a modern, high-performing and AI-enabled partner sales organization.

  • The role reports into the Director, Data Collection & Insights, within the GTM Data & Insights team, which is part of the Global Revenue Operations organization.

Job Responsibilities:

  • Lead the HP Data Insights Adoption with channel partners and HP internal sales teams.

  • Create adoption strategy and materials for the descriptive, predictive and prescriptive insights that help teams prioritize customers, identify opportunities and act faster.

  • Drive outcomes including higher sales productivity, faster renewal, upgrade and attach cycles, and stronger marketing response.

  • Steer, based on user feedback, how insights are delivered and activated through partner portals, internal analytics, APIs, EDI, CRM and marketing automation.

  • Enable responsible AI and machine-learning use of partner, customer, product and market data for predictions and recommendations.

  • Promote a trusted, centralized data approach, reducing duplicate solutions and strengthening transparency, governance and usability.

Key deliverables/accountabilities:

  • Data Insights value realization: measurable substantial business impact from actionable insights that are embedded in partner and sales workflows, with clear adoption and business-value measures.

  • Adoption growth: increased HP data insights consumption through the HP Partner Portal and HP APIs.

  • Reliable, AI-ready data products that partners and sales teams can understand, trust and activate.

Education & Experience Recommended:

  • Bachelor or master's degree in business, information systems, data, technology or a related discipline, or equivalent experience.

  • Typically 7+ years of relevant experience, including sales, category, business development, information architecture, data products or analytics.

  • Proven ability to translate business processes into scalable information models and product requirements.

  • Strong business acumen and deep understanding of sales and sales-management processes.
